Ledge, ditch the F5 BIOS, it did not play nice for me. Try the F7a beta BIOS. I was having trouble with 4GHz and a lot of voltages as well w/ F5. After flashing to F7a, I can run 4GHz with 1.3175v set in BIOS w/ LLC enabled giving me a rock solid 1.29v according to cpu-z, OCCT and ET6. I also only have 1.35 PLL, 1.22v cpu termination and 1.32v MCH. It SHOULD make a big difference for you as well.
